North Carolina State University in Raleigh, NC is seeking a Temporary Undergraduate Research Technician to perform wet lab tasks, DNA/RNA extraction from fungal tissues, and to maintain mycological cultures with aseptic precision.
You will execute PCR and qPCR, run gel electrophoresis, and contribute to plant pathogen assessments while communicating clearly and training student workers in a dynamic lab. The schedule is 8:30am–5pm, Monday–Friday, with benefits for temporary employees.

The Temporary Undergraduate Research Technician will be engaged in various activities such as wet lab tasks, DNA extraction from fungal herbarium specimens. Proficiency in aseptic techniques is essential, as the new hire will be responsible for maintaining mycological cultures with precision. This involves isolating RNA/DNA from mycological tissues, performing techniques like PCR and quantitative PCR, executing agarose gel electrophoresis, and conducting plant pathological assessments.
